Hi,

does anyone here boot os2008 on their n800 from mmc? i recently noticed a problem with installing programs. when i try to install programs after booting from mmc, i get the error "unable to install" with no further explanations.

i thought it was a repository problem so i messed with a lot of the repositories. i later copied the original os on flash onto mmc. tried installing after booting from mmc again, no dice. i boot into flash and tried installing the same program (omweather), and it worked.

are there any fixes for this problem or anyone else experience the same problem?

i'm running the latest version of os2008. thanks

omweather was installed into int flash, and then OS was then cloned. Booting from MMC with omweather running, no problem so far. Load-applet>List processes to check if any pgm is running without your knowledge, e.g. VNC viewer, rdesktop things like that will stop pgm from installing. Write a test file to your MMC, it becomes readonly when it has corrupt files. Sometime remove virtual mem and re-create it again may solve problem. Oh, AppManager>Tools>log... what does that show, if any?

I tried your suggestions but it's still not working.

Here's my log file:

hildon-application-manager 2.0.2
apt-worker: Running 'dpkg --configure dpkg' to clean up the journal.
dpkg: parse error, in file `/var/lib/dpkg/updates/0000' near line 1:
field name `<?xml' must be followed by colon
-----
Installing omweather 0.19.4
dpkg: parse error, in file `/var/lib/dpkg/updates/0000' near line 1:
field name `<?xml' must be followed by colon
E: Sub-process /usr/bin/dpkg returned an error code (2)
apt-worker: Running 'dpkg --configure dpkg' to clean up the journal.
dpkg: parse error, in file `/var/lib/dpkg/updates/0000' near line 1:
field name `<?xml' must be followed by colon

It's strange that I am able to install it when booting from flash, but unable to install when booting from mmc.

omweather is not the only program affected, i can't install a lot of other programs also.

I had similar problem during the last day of my 2007Os, exactly the same. Cannot install prog while on MMC boot, ok to install while int flash boot. I cannot trace down to a particular pgm, but I do recall it happen after a 'difficult' install, I think it is python2.5; but then, the 2008Os came, it is convenient, that I just flash upgrade and the problem seems disappear. I would really look hard on your last install. If still no answer, I would look at the memory card, or preferably, try to clone on a different card, see whether that solved the problem. I have cloned 2008 OS to 8G SDHC, failed. and then succeded with 2G and 1G. That is why my system signiture is
